Output 17c3af4a432e06ef160e6284a7017f38106186c8e5d475db75f5fa586887c8a6:1

value
887463
script pubkey
OP_0 OP_PUSHBYTES_20 23ef64b253a6878c3045de4e0eee627fb0a3c4ae
address
bc1qy0hkfvjn56rccvz9me8qamnz07c2839wq7ta65
transaction
17c3af4a432e06ef160e6284a7017f38106186c8e5d475db75f5fa586887c8a6
spent
true